Spain enters the June 26, 2026, FIFA World Cup Group H clash in Guadalajara as the consensus favorite due to its elite FIFA ranking, possession-dominant style under Luis de la Fuente, and recent success including the 2024 European Championship. Key attackers such as Lamine Yamal and Pedri provide attacking depth and creativity that contrast with Uruguay’s more direct, high-intensity approach led by Marcelo Bielsa. Uruguay brings World Cup pedigree, physical pressing, set-piece threats, and midfield anchors like Fede Valverde, yet recent international windows have shown inconsistency. Head-to-head results favor Spain, with no losses in recent encounters, while the match’s positioning as both teams’ final group fixture adds stakes for qualification scenarios. Trader pricing reflects Spain’s overall edge tempered by the competitive nature of a single World Cup group-stage fixture.
